Description

  • Sebastião Salgado
  • ‘Brazil’, 1986
  • Silver print
Tirage argentique. Avec le timbre sec copyright dans la marge inférieure, et signé, titré et daté au crayon au verso. Monté sous passe-partout.

Literature

Sebastião Salgado, An Archaeology of the Industrial Age Workers, Londres, Phaidon, 2002, ill. p. 314;
Eduardo Galeano, Fred Ritchin, Sebastião Salgado. An Uncertain Grace, New York, Aperture, 1990, ill. p. 17.

Condition

This print is in overall excellent condition. With very slight undulation to the left edge of the print.
